WebCertain environmental conditions, such as high temperatures and low humidity can increase a fertilizer's burn potential. By applying no more than 1 pound of actual nitrogen per 1,000 square feet per application, the burn potential is reduced dramatically. Most quick release nitrogen sources are in a soluble form that enables them to leach readily. WebIn 2015, 429,000 tonnes of nitrogen and 155,000 tonnes of phosphorus were applied to New Zealand soil as fertiliser. Since 1990, the annual application of nitrogen via fertiliser has increased 627% (from 59,000 tonnes in 1990 to 429,000 tonnes in 2015). The annual amount of phosphorus applied as fertiliser peaked at 219,000 tonnes in 2005, but ...
